Always turn off hyphenation; it makes .\" way too many mistakes in technical documents. .if n .ad l .nh .SH "NAME" generator\-gtk \- Sega Genesis/Megadrive emulator .SH "SYNOPSIS" .IX Header "SYNOPSIS" generator-gtk \fB[options]\fR \fB[rom\-file]\fR .SH "DESCRIPTION" .IX Header "DESCRIPTION" generator-gtk is a platform independent Sega Genesis/Megadrive emulator with a \s-1GTK+2\s0 user interface, using \s-1SDL\s0 for display/audio/input. .PP generator-gtk is a modified version of Generator by James Ponder based on version 0.35. It is known to work on FreeBSD, NetBSD and Linux. .PP generator-gtk has some features not found in original Generator: .IP "\-" 4 Support for \s-1BZIP2\s0, \s-1GZIP\s0 and \s-1ZIP\s0 compressed ROMs i.e., no more manual decompression or wasted disk space. Yay! .IP "\-" 4 Support for X11's XVideo hardware acceleration by \s-1SDL\s0 for faster and smoother graphics. .IP "\-" 4 Fullscreen support with or without the classic color frame. .IP "\-" 4 \&\s-1SDL\s0 audio support (in favour of \s-1OSS\s0 Audio) which means you can use ESound and others for sharing the sound device among other applications. .IP "\-" 4 Optional mute playing i.e., if you don't have a soundcard or the soundcard is busy you can still play. .IP "\-" 4 Support for 48kHz sample rate (needs driver support). .IP "\-" 4 Automagic \s-1CPU\s0 usage reduction which is especially cool for notebooks. The unpatched Generator uses more or less as much \s-1CPU\s0 as it can get even if needs far less than 10% on any modern system. .IP "\-" 4 Working support for Game Genie codes. .SH "OPTIONS" .IX Header "OPTIONS" .IP "\-a" 4 .IX Item "-a" Arcade mode. Start emulation immediately, in fullscreen. Only useful if a \s-1ROM\s0 file is also provided on the command line. This option is very useful with frontends. .IP "\-d" 4 .IX Item "-d" Debug mode. This is for debugging emulated \s-1ROM\s0 code. This option adds a Debug menu item to the \s-1UI\s0, with options for disassembling \s-1RAM\s0 and \s-1ROM\s0, and a console that displays the machine registers and offers breakpoints and single-stepping. .Sp Note: The debug console can still be activated without the \fB\-d\fR option (by pressing control-D), however the disassembler will not be available. .IP "\-r \fIregion\fR" 4 .IX Item "-r region" Set region to \fBeurope\fR, \fBjapan\fR, or \fBusa\fR. Default: autodetected, or read from config file. This option should only be needed to work around broken or mis-detected ROMs. .IP "\-w \fIwork-dir\fR" 4 .IX Item "-w work-dir" Set work directory. Default: current directory. .IP "\-c \fIconfig-file\fR" 4 .IX Item "-c config-file" Use alternative config file. Default: \fB~/.genrc\fR. .SH "FILES" .IX Header "FILES" .IP "~/.genrc" 4 .IX Item "~/.genrc" Default config file (may be changed with \fB\-c\fR option). This file is created when the Emulation \-> Options \-> Save button is pressed, and (if it exists) is loaded when \fBgenerator-gtk\fR starts up. The file is human-editable and well-commented, although users are expected to use the Options dialog to change the settings. .IP "\s-1ROM\s0 files" 4 .IX Item "ROM files" \&\s-1ROM\s0 types supported: .rom or .smd interleaved (autodetected). \s-1ROM\s0 files may be compressed with bzip2, gzip, or zip. .SH "SEE ALSO" .IX Header "SEE ALSO" .IP "Original Generator manual:" 4 .IX Item "Original Generator manual:" http://www.squish.net/generator/manual.html .Sp This is the documentation for unmodified Generator 0.35.
